Program: Unison Health & Community Services - Youth Clinic

Organization: Unison Health and Community Services
Description of Services: Healthcare and counselling services for youth aged 13-29 years * access to a nurse practitioner or a doctor and mental health counselors * referrals are made to other appropriate services as needed

Services include:
  • free pregnancy testing and options
  • free sexually transmitted infections (STI) testing
  • birth control
  • emergency contraceptives
  • vaccinations
  • mental health support services
  • sexual health information

Fees: Free
Eligibility - Population(s) Served: Youth Clinic-ages 13-29/Primary Care services for all ages
Application: Walk-in and Appointments
